From: Frank Kardel Date: Sat, 14 Oct 2006 08:51:43 +0000 (+0000) Subject: ntp_io.c: X-Git-Tag: NTP_4_2_3P58~1 X-Git-Url: http://git.ipfire.org/cgi-bin/gitweb.cgi?a=commitdiff_plain;h=e94ebb7cc1fb0164fda53aa71226be2deef13716;p=thirdparty%2Fntp.git ntp_io.c: Bug #715 (& dupe 723): findlocalinterface() in update_interface can be replaced by a simple address to interface lookup. This avoids tripping over the Linux strategy to return the localhost address when attempting to send to an IPv6 address of a local interface.
